Sump Pump Installation in Boston, MA
Sump pump installation services provide a reliable solution for homeowners looking to protect their property from basement flooding and excess water accumulation. This process involves installing a pump system that automatically activates when water levels rise, diverting water away from the foundation to prevent water damage. Projects typically include installing new sump pumps in existing basements, upgrading outdated systems, or adding sump pumps to homes in areas prone to heavy rainfall or high water tables. Understanding the different types of sump pumps, such as pedestal or submersible models, and how they integrate with drainage systems can help property owners make informed decisions before requesting installation services.
Homeowners considering sump pump installation often want to know about the system’s capacity, maintenance requirements, and how it fits within their existing foundation and drainage setup. It’s also common to inquire about the best placement for the sump basin and the power sources needed for continuous operation. Proper installation ensures the sump pump functions effectively during storms or heavy rain, providing peace of mind against unexpected flooding. Sump Pump Installation Questions
What is a sump pump? A sump pump is a device installed in the basement or crawl space to remove excess water and prevent flooding during heavy rains or groundwater seepage.
Where should a sump pump be installed? It is typically placed in a sump pit located in the lowest part of the property to effectively collect and pump out water.
What are common reasons to install a sump pump? Installation is often requested to protect against basement flooding, water damage, and excess moisture in areas prone to high groundwater levels.
How does a sump pump work? It detects rising water levels in the sump pit and automatically activates to pump water away from the property to a designated drainage area.
